diff options
author | V3n3RiX <venerix@redcorelinux.org> | 2018-01-31 20:30:04 +0000 |
---|---|---|
committer | V3n3RiX <venerix@redcorelinux.org> | 2018-01-31 20:30:04 +0000 |
commit | 4650985dd0e898b82e0d2ec225931297d4fadccf (patch) | |
tree | eb0e8002cf3ebf1009110b6fec47fa90f873d824 /metadata/news | |
parent | 67f76a858f1ac826bd8a550d756d9ec6e340ed4f (diff) |
gentoo resync : 31.01.2018
Diffstat (limited to 'metadata/news')
-rw-r--r-- | metadata/news/2018-01-30-portage-rsync-verification/2018-01-30-portage-rsync-verification.en.txt | 50 | ||||
-rw-r--r-- | metadata/news/Manifest | 30 | ||||
-rw-r--r-- | metadata/news/Manifest.files.gz | bin | 19029 -> 19210 bytes | |||
-rw-r--r-- | metadata/news/timestamp.chk | 2 | ||||
-rw-r--r-- | metadata/news/timestamp.commit | 2 |
5 files changed, 67 insertions, 17 deletions
diff --git a/metadata/news/2018-01-30-portage-rsync-verification/2018-01-30-portage-rsync-verification.en.txt b/metadata/news/2018-01-30-portage-rsync-verification/2018-01-30-portage-rsync-verification.en.txt new file mode 100644 index 000000000000..1964855e4d1a --- /dev/null +++ b/metadata/news/2018-01-30-portage-rsync-verification/2018-01-30-portage-rsync-verification.en.txt @@ -0,0 +1,50 @@ +Title: Portage rsync tree verification +Author: Michał Górny <mgorny@gentoo.org> +Posted: 2018-01-30 +Revision: 1 +News-Item-Format: 2.0 +Display-If-Installed: sys-apps/portage + +Starting with sys-apps/portage-2.3.21, Portage will verify the Gentoo +repository after rsync by default. + +The new verification is intended for users who are syncing via rsync. +Users syncing via git or other methods are not affected, and complete +verification for them will be provided in the future. + +The verification is implemented via app-portage/gemato. Currently, +the whole repository is verified after syncing. On systems with slow +hard drives, this could take around 2 minutes. If you wish to disable +it, you can disable the 'rsync-verify' USE flag on sys-apps/portage +or set 'sync-rsync-verify-metamanifest = no' in your repos.conf. + +Please note that the verification currently does not prevent Portage +from using the repository after syncing. If 'emerge --sync' fails, +do not install any packages and retry syncing. In case of prolonged +or frequent verification failures, please make sure to report a bug +including the failing mirror addresses (found in emerge.log). + +The verification uses information from the binary keyring provided +by the app-crypt/gentoo-keys package. The keys are refreshed +from the keyserver before every use in order to check for revocation. +The post-sync verification ensures that the authenticity of the key +package itself is verified. However, manual verification is required +before the first use. + +On Gentoo installations created using installation media that included +portage-2.3.22, the keys will already be covered by the installation +media signatures. On existing installations, you need to manually +compare the primary key fingerprint (reported by gemato on every sync) +against the official Gentoo keys [1]. An example gemato output is: + + INFO:root:Valid OpenPGP signature found: + INFO:root:- primary key: 1234567890ABCDEF1234567890ABCDEF12345678 + INFO:root:- subkey: FEDCBA0987654321FEDCBA0987654321FEDCBA09 + +Please note that the above snippet does not include the real key id +on purpose. The primary key actually printed by gemato must match +the 'Gentoo Portage Snapshot Signing Key' on the website. Please make +sure to also check the certificate used for the secure connection +to the site! + +[1]:https://www.gentoo.org/downloads/signatures/ diff --git a/metadata/news/Manifest b/metadata/news/Manifest index c6230b7ab717..1282bacf75e6 100644 --- a/metadata/news/Manifest +++ b/metadata/news/Manifest @@ -1,23 +1,23 @@ -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 -MANIFEST Manifest.files.gz 19029 BLAKE2B ce06494761e0d519b11c6e90add9344a529739b54c9ed439c6eb0d3079283090966ce78b3efa765cef03592f2eaec8c4c45822e3207427dcebc59e2f0903d3f6 SHA512 8d6322320c30905299bf49afe5ddebe7341c62d7ac02b6106a345e4a6a33d933c49dd510b54c28fe6aa6d79991d2e352cd49e7bf4ed3e8baa812bdd04b33f2bf -TIMESTAMP 2018-01-27T17:08:31Z +MANIFEST Manifest.files.gz 19210 BLAKE2B ef1f48dd093e1998551b0b59e75894e45eb7ca46c1a209056e180347c77c96964d5ad0ad9fb97af17a3dc4b5e22e7a68a01179290c2f353189c8e372de002ca6 SHA512 c6dea10b94a1651479a6ecf044fbeebd1514365c2d442a51f76fbb3537f37b434ac895c1042ca2d48fa1ef69ea3a2d992f9142e08c893c09c4c4157458ca9547 +TIMESTAMP 2018-01-31T19:38:17Z -----BEGIN PGP SIGNATURE----- -iQKTBAEBCgB9FiEE4dartjv8+0ugL98c7FkO6skYklAFAlpssg9fFIAAAAAALgAo +iQKTBAEBCgB9FiEE4dartjv8+0ugL98c7FkO6skYklAFAlpyGylfFIAAAAAALgAo a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ldEUx RDZBQkI2M0JGQ0ZCNEJBMDJGREYxQ0VDNTkwRUVBQzkxODkyNTAACgkQ7FkO6skY -klANBhAApPRLOAQMhmFCU0RaaIxdGSBOUmBeOPFbXp7795rNbJM41pm+ybauJ5IL -jztaj1VNkwY1dJCDiCND2l8OFzbR5EyebPf+6OXx6sv8xx9dLSZfTBDH4YmFUq1o -Slka69XvionvoJSbIAdr2kbKHZaNKWZg2V0yB7A6Im2tQzZrl/UGByRUqchubF9F -AGiMexjZ6/vjvvUnuUoajWqOyHn/zrTuWTeiOvYve/vCwSrAVgRNIum6k7pHlqeL -XNkRoeueV43ir2A49gwYfJLjtKztu++qjj8Qfs8cRYi1S277E26xy11nZo0l9pV0 -uqIskTrI3zXDZYQPl80kXMsE4Gt8tyHeIi7XP2yyvA3iQoJlND6hI/BsU8Px7KZ0 -ifbQoPwxCU4PD0oST/BwrPtf1FXg8KcUiZymGvzsUUm1/F+7k+QeIckj1t4JM3bG -1TLGQeGYQF1MVbc4eA0X0EjnRGZoPNuaE/rSlvrJAbvBtT2ZGlecvVEjwXwhnofF -zZE8P40uSwJgiKwRv+s1dxTcLUyK6KLHL2Wf/Bkq5EPJn/XsO0BRZCZyIjS8U3Mg -/StMb4ZpxPYIYtO3vSased7gajbB6U/6SUDmHBOj+w0kVnswUPzist6DJf3tBYZQ -4Qq8cAMKTdxofaYrc0SCqpdhL97/Sl6t5pzbxL0GpIrapCFmgrg= -=QIOB +klAfKQ//ez1R5smKzp2BGMXLDFq0qxR0muVlmqGE6qLyQYTTeWQHOBcOMPVkKqP6 +dSLF36KxALra/aFWhyR47IwndSJN+dU0da0CUEi5/Q88f+/C2j/YOEZTcbIQQXcj +NoM3xuLPBUjvQJLBAAobbL1+QBrDr80UzSoH6aggEPuoxWPVbASeplVoZKIqizT3 +7RnDdyYtsvMwO04Zux9uugd9EDBKIuZhwrVck0kA8I+QVATRbnZJRZ60pgIbC0PT +52oWXMjINsNhMts/DfsfuxN1fHpJRh+xYexwUCC+lOGgLKGq3zY0dd+HMkMRo1iD +RMUEfY6PCve+w2MHpeUe7+1FpWPFl1Z9XPTPaaMQ0L0YDwj/Wj7BVBhXwtpvDwId +wTok2f/kees1SaRHIwU5LMqjf8vLTc8j5ALYy0rFfQgqbZ0Rii5KeJSH02nXQUmq +FBpYbJrJsJgV78JJ/nF0ia+9F7kGj/+TLOmIgSkNFWuKZGNNEZCicIA21oQvuIji +Mwo5I/qz6aiXoB6hqB+fEbmUjus6DPMT7AWl3XBt0HXnGp5Z/DrbkJRyqIkhLL01 +AdM5Vr58QjIEvTwnV7rztKqVbkB/mfm0c2r1h2e9lfexmnZ4JfcD5rs77AZ1p/8C +xkYgtzMXSFM9OuVCQkqF83teMMWSajVr6AFXvt/jus+ue3FbiSI= +=pabT -----END PGP SIGNATURE----- diff --git a/metadata/news/Manifest.files.gz b/metadata/news/Manifest.files.gz Binary files differindex 33e3bcf4edc1..8ec9f7333c8e 100644 --- a/metadata/news/Manifest.files.gz +++ b/metadata/news/Manifest.files.gz diff --git a/metadata/news/timestamp.chk b/metadata/news/timestamp.chk index d12dcf7f326f..e66e26e2a913 100644 --- a/metadata/news/timestamp.chk +++ b/metadata/news/timestamp.chk @@ -1 +1 @@ -Sat, 27 Jan 2018 17:08:28 +0000 +Wed, 31 Jan 2018 19:38:13 +0000 diff --git a/metadata/news/timestamp.commit b/metadata/news/timestamp.commit index 506d9dbc3c68..6f63d3271d41 100644 --- a/metadata/news/timestamp.commit +++ b/metadata/news/timestamp.commit @@ -1 +1 @@ -00797101a9f1a77aab802fde89ea51b3f169553d 1516816604 2018-01-24T17:56:44+00:00 +74c7e9808df77096ca393871e88a4991978c4786 1517298256 2018-01-30T07:44:16+00:00 |